Screening for lung cancer with low-dose CT

Summary
Low-dose computed tomography (CT) shows promise for early lung cancer screening in high-risk individuals. However, challenges like lung nodule detection and radiation dose require further research.

Background:
- Lung cancer is the leading cause of cancer mortality globally.
- Early detection is crucial for reducing lung cancer mortality.
- Chest X-ray has proven insufficient for early lung cancer detection.
Purpose of the Study:
- To review the role of low-dose computed tomography (CT) in early lung cancer screening.
- To present results from past and current trials on low-dose CT screening.
- To discuss controversies and limitations associated with low-dose CT for lung cancer detection.
Main Methods:
- Review of existing literature and clinical trials on low-dose CT for lung cancer screening.
- Analysis of data concerning lung nodule detection rates.
- Evaluation of cost-effectiveness and radiation dose associated with low-dose CT.
Main Results:
- Low-dose CT is a potential tool for screening high-risk populations.
- High rates of lung nodules present a challenge in interpretation.
- Cost-effectiveness and radiation dose are significant considerations.
Conclusions:
- Low-dose CT offers potential for early lung cancer detection but faces challenges.
- Further research is needed to optimize screening protocols and address limitations.
- Careful patient selection and interpretation are essential for effective screening.
